Ariz. Admin. Code § R2-12-1103 - Notary Public Bonds
A.
Notaries public shall purchase a bond in the amount of $5,000 before being
commissioned as a notary public. The original bond shall be filed with the
clerk of the superior court in the applicant's county of residence. A copy of
the bond shall be filed with the applicant's application form submitted to the
Secretary of State's Office.
B. The
bond shall contain, on its face, the oath of office for the notary public as
specified in A.R.S. §
38-233(B).
This oath shall be as specified in A.R.S. §
38-231.
The notary shall endorse the oath on the face of the bond, immediately below
the oath, by signing the notary's name under which the person has applied to be
commissioned as a notary and exactly as the name appears on the notary
application form filed with the Secretary of State's Office.
